Training centre

Bhubaneswar: The foundation stone of an incubation and skill development centre was laid in the Utkal University on Wednesday. The university aims to start the centre by April next year to train budding entrepreneurs in all sectors to set up socially relevant start-ups. Nalco will fund the centre, which will be built at an estimated cost of Rs1.75 crore.   

Sports push

Bhubaneswar: Students from schools, colleges and universities can take advantage of the warm-up stadium of the Kalinga Stadium. The Odisha government is planning to encourage educational institutions, which do not have their own tracks and grounds the use of the facilities of the stadium.

Brave act

Berhampur:  Rutu Nahak, a class X student of Bauribandhu High School in Ganjam district called off her marriage for the sake of her education. Driven by a strong a willpower, the 15-year-old girl defied the decision of her parents to fulfil her dream of becoming an IPS officer.
